Types of Coach Barrel Bags

Coach defines luxury accessibility, and the barrel bag is a standout in their lineup. Recognizable for its cylindrical silhouette, this bag is available in several distinct types. Understanding these varieties will help you select a bag that matches your style, capacity needs, and versatility preferences.

1. Classic Barrel Bag

  • Characterized by a true cylindrical shape with modest dimensions.
  • Usually features a top zipper closure, a short handle, and often a detachable longer strap.
  • Available in pebbled leather, smooth leather, and signature coated canvas.

2. Nolita Barrel Bag

  • A compact version aimed at people who prefer a smaller, more manageable everyday bag.
  • Offered in a range of materials, including Coach’s signature canvas and new iterations in denim.
  • Versatile as a wristlet, clutch, or crossbody with detachable straps.

3. Coachtopia Barrel Bag

  • An eco-conscious line, focusing on using recycled/upcycled leathers and innovative processes.
  • Features modern detailing and sometimes playful color-blocking or limited edition runs.
  • Appeals to sustainability-minded fashion lovers.

4. Orion Barrel Bag

  • Focused on luxury with glovetanned leather and detailed handcrafting.
  • Slightly larger and more structured, bringing a dressier element.
  • Ideal for those seeking a more elevated or professional look.

5. Signature Fabric Variations

  • Including Signature Jacquard and Canvas options.
  • Combine Coach’s iconic logo patterns with barrel styling for extra recognition.
  • Typically paired with smooth leather accents for comfort and style.

6. Special Collaboration or Seasonal Designs

  • Occasionally Coach releases limited-edition or collab barrel bags in unique materials or prints.
  • Great for collectors or anyone who wants a bag that stands out.

Material Choices for Coach Barrel Bags

Selecting the right material affects not only the aesthetic but also the durability and feel of your bag. Here’s a breakdown of popular choices with practical pros and cons:

1. Leather (Pebbled, Glovetanned, Smooth)

  • Pros: Durable, ages well, luxurious look and feel.
  • Cons: Can require more care, sensitive to scratches or moisture in some finishes.

2. Signature Coated Canvas

  • Pros: Scratch-resistant, lightweight, iconic Coach pattern.
  • Cons: Slightly less formal than full leather, some buyers prefer the feel of natural leather.

3. Jacquard Fabric

  • Pros: Rich texture, unique appearance, lighter weight.
  • Cons: Can be prone to snagging, may show wear faster in high-friction areas.

4. Denim and Specialty Fabrics

  • Pros: Trendy, casual-friendly, easy to pair with jeans and relaxed looks.
  • Cons: More casual, fabric may fade over time.

5. Eco-Friendly/Upcycled Leather (Coachtopia)

  • Pros: Supports sustainability, modern styling, good durability.
  • Cons: Variability in texture or finish due to upcycling.

Practical Tips & Best Practices for Choosing and Using Coach Barrel Bags

  1. Assess Your Essentials: Lay out what you usually carry. Choose your bag size accordingly—the Nolita fits less, while Orion and Classic accommodate a bit more.
  2. Check the Strap: If comfort is key, choose an adjustable or padded strap, especially for all-day wear. Detachable straps add versatility.
  3. Consider Material Care: Leather ages beautifully but needs protection from rain and scratches. Canvas is lower-maintenance but less formal.
  4. Zipper Quality: A smooth zipper is a must. Test it before buying, if possible.
  5. Weight When Empty: Try the bag in-store—Coach bags are rarely heavy, but some structured leather options might be.
  6. Interior Organization: Look for internal pockets or organizers if you like everything in its place.
  7. Store Safely: Keep your bag in its dust bag, stuffed with tissue to maintain shape when not in use.
  8. Switching Straps: Many barrels accommodate third-party straps, letting you personalize your look further.
  9. Care for Hardware: Regularly wipe the zippers and clasps to prevent tarnishing.
  10. Seasonal Rotation: Use lighter-colored/fabric bags in spring and summer, darker leathers for autumn/winter.

FAQ

  1. What exactly is a Coach barrel bag?
    A Coach barrel bag features a cylindrical, structured silhouette, usually with a zipper top, short handles, and often a detachable longer strap. Its shape is inspired by classic duffel bags but in a more compact, stylish form, suitable for everyday or elevated occasions.

  2. Which Coach barrel bag is best for daily use?
    The Classic Barrel or Nolita Barrel bags are ideal for daily use due to their practical size, lightweight design, and comfortable strap options. Choose canvas for easy care, or leather for a more sophisticated vibe.

  3. How much does a Coach barrel bag typically hold?
    While sizes vary, most barrel bags accommodate essentials like a phone, wallet, keys, makeup, a small notebook, and sunglasses. The Nolita is more compact (cardholder, keys, lipstick), while Orion or Classic models fit a bit more.

  4. Are Coach barrel bags good for evening occasions?
    Yes. Smaller barrels in leather or signature print finish an evening look beautifully—most can double as clutches by removing the strap.

  5. How do I care for my leather Coach barrel bag?
    Wipe regularly with a clean, dry cloth. Use a leather conditioner every few months and store in its dust bag when not in use. Avoid prolonged exposure to water or direct sunlight to preserve color and finish.

  6. Can I adjust or swap the strap on my barrel bag?
    Most recent models feature detachable and adjustable straps—ideal for crossbody or shoulder use. You can also swap in third-party straps for a custom look, but make sure hardware fits securely.

  7. Is there a difference between coated canvas and signature jacquard?
    Yes. Coated canvas has a smooth, wipeable finish and features the iconic Coach pattern; jacquard is woven fabric with texture, offering a softer, more tactile feel.

  8. Which barrel bag models are best for travel?
    Go for Signature Jacquard or canvas models—they’re lightweight, easy to clean, and have enough space for your on-the-go essentials. The Classic Barrel is also a great pick for travel-chic style.

  9. How long can a Coach barrel bag last?
    With correct care, Coach barrel bags can last for many years. Leather develops a beautiful patina, and hardware is built to last. Fabric models show wear faster but remain stylish and serviceable if well-maintained.
